"A Head Boy or Head Girl is a Seventh Year student who has authority over prefects and students at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ry. They wear a badge.
"At the beginning of the school year the Headmaster appoints, new prefects as well as one Head Boy and one Head Girl from all of the seventh-year students. On the Hogwarts Express, the Head Boy or Head Girl of their house has to go through all the things that is needed to know to be a prefect. Most Head Boys and Head Girls were once prefects, although that is not a necessity; one example being James Potter, who was Head Boy despite not being a prefect.
"The trophy room contained a list of Head Boys (and presumably Head Girls). The Head Boy and Head Girl are in charge of the prefects and should be an example to the other students. Head Boys and Girls also had the special privilege of being able to use the Prefect's Bathroom.

"Known Head Boys and Girls
Albus Dumbledore (1898-99)
Tom Marvolo Riddle (1944-45)
James Potter (1977-78)
Lily Evans (1977-78)
Bill Weasley (1988-89)"

"Head Boy/Head Girl
There is one Head Boy and one Head Girl each year at Hogwarts. These are students in their seventh year who are given some of the responsibility of maintaining order and administering discipline. They are also in charge of the Prefects. Percy Weasley was Head Boy in his seventh year. James and Lily were also Head Boy and Girl. Apparently, one does not have to be a Prefect every year to become Head Boy, since James was not a Prefect in his fifth year but was made Head Boy in his seventh."
